The fabric, a satin weave of cotton, feels smoother than standard cotton and gives a slight sheen that elevates the piece beyond everyday wear.
The fabric quality is impressive for the price point. A satin-weave cotton gives you the comfort and breathable nature of cotton while offering a more polished surface. It drapes well, feels soft on the skin, and holds shape better than flatter weaves. During wear it remained comfortable through a full day—no stiffness, no pulling at seams. The printed design still looked crisp after a gentle wash, which suggests decent durability. That said, satin-weave fabrics may need slightly more care (cold wash, avoid heavy abrasion) to maintain their sheen and finish over time.
